Why is treatment sometimes done earlier than the payment?
When a case is urgent and vital, hospitals often proceed with delivering medical care right away to save a life, even before the finalisation of admission procedures. Usually, when this happens, hospitals put the bill on our credit until the funds are transferred to their accounts. That’s why the chronology can sometimes be in disorder.

About infections
Marufa Akter has been diagnosed with typhoid fever, a serious bacterial infection that spreads through contaminated food and water. The illness commonly causes prolonged high fever, severe body aches, weakness, abdominal pain, and loss of appetite. If not treated properly, typhoid can lead to dangerous complications such as intestinal bleeding or infection spreading throughout the body. With timely medical care and appropriate antibiotics, most patients recover fully and regain their normal strength and health.

Background
Marufa Akter is a gentle and hardworking 14-year-old girl who lives with her poor family under difficult financial conditions. Her father, Nur Islam, works as a rickshaw puller and earns only around 8,000 BDT per month, which is not enough to support the six-member family, including her two school-going brothers Ibrahim Khalil and Jalil and her elderly grandfather. During a seasonal outbreak in the area, poor hygiene conditions, use of common toilets, and lack of safe drinking water caused Marufa to develop high fever, severe cough, and abdominal pain, making her condition weaker day by day. Her worried mother took her to Saheda Gafur Ibrahim General Hospital, where doctors diagnosed her with typhoid and admitted her for urgent treatment and close monitoring. Without proper treatment, the infection could become severe and lead to dangerous health complications, but the family is struggling to continue the medical expenses and learned about Helpster Charity through volunteer Abdur Rahman.

Prognosis
Doctors have advised treatment with parenteral antibiotics along with supportive therapy to effectively control Marufa Akter’s typhoid infection. With timely and complete treatment, her fever will gradually subside, her strength will return, and she will be able to resume her studies and daily activities without long-term effects. Proper medical care will also prevent the infection from spreading and protect her vital organs. However, if left untreated, typhoid can lead to severe complications such as intestinal perforation, internal bleeding, bloodstream infection, and even become life-threatening. Early intervention is therefore essential to ensure her full recovery and safeguard her future health.
